    Morgan Davis

    Morgan Davis

    Bearly's House of Blues & Ribs 1579 Grafton St, Halifax

    Morgan Davis is a Canadian blues singer, guitarist, and songwriter. He was born and spent his childhood in Detroit, Michigan, before relocating to Toronto, Ontario, Canada. He moved to Halifax, Nova Scotia, in 2001. His song "Why'd You Lie" was a hit for Colin James and featured on James' 1988 debut album.

    Caito Macdonald Trio

    Caito Macdonald Trio

    Barrington Steakhouse & Oyster Bar 1662 Barrington St., Halifax

    Caito Macdonald is a percussionist and composer from Dartmouth, NS. Caito's musical style is rooted in the jazz tradition, and he performs at various jazz gigs around Halifax. Caito's trio plays every Friday at the Barrington Steakhouse, and he can also be heard in the local rock/fusion band 'Under the Bus'.
